The Hague International Law Journal officially presents the publication of its second quarterly publication for 2022.
Dear readers, authors and reviewers,
Below you will discover the second volume publication of The Hague International Law Review 2022.
It is the second out of 2 digital publications and one curated print publication that are planned for release in the year 2022. The 2/2022 THI Law Review quarterly contains contributions from various authors trained in International Law, with diverse academic backgrounds and areas of expertise. This quarterly offers the readers a collection of papers that touch on various areas of International and European law, seeking to provide a legal perspective on recent topics that concern not only legal practitioners and academics but also a broad range of audiences interested in law development.
The theme of the 2/2022 THI Law Review:
Recent developments in International Law
Published authors and works:
- THE TRANSBOUNDARY FRAMEWORK REGIME OF THE GANGES RIVER BETWEEN INDIA AND BANGLADESH,
Merel Terwisscha van Scheltinga, LL.M. Candidate Environmental Law, The Arctic University of Norway; LL.B. Graduate The Hague University of Applied Sciences.
- GUN POLICY: A COMPARATIVE ANALYSIS, Jacqueline Thomas, Honors Political Science and French Student, Villanova University; Junior Editor, The Hague International.
- ANALYZING THE DIMENSIONS AND LIMITATIONS OF DUE PROCESS IN TRANSNATIONAL ARBITRATION DISPUTES, Rishav Ray, BA. LL.B. (Hons) candidate at School of Law, Christ University Bangalore. Learner at Asian Institute of Alternative Dispute Resolution, Malaysia. and Subhadeepa Sen, Editor at Business, Financial and Law Technology Law Review; LL.B. Candidate, School of Law, Christ University, Bangalore.
